Taiwanese stainless steel wire exports & imports drop in Apr

According to the Taiwanese Customs, Taiwan exported approximately 900 tons and imported about 560 tons of stainless steel wire in April, dropping by 37% and 13% from the previous month respectively.

Taiwan exported around 230 tons to the US, sliding by 20% from 290 tons in a month ago. The other major destinations were Japan (about 200 tons) and Thailand (about 80 tons).

Moreover, the top three suppliers included Vietnam (around 200 tons), Japan (about 110 tons), and India (about 50 tons).
